Improve git commit hygiene and session naming in Claude Code with hooks that attach conversation context and suggest titles before exit.

Overview

codeofficer-marketplace is a plugin marketplace for the Ship phase that adds git commit context enforcement and session rename suggestions to Claude Code workflows.

What is this marketplace?

  • 2 plugins: git-commit-conversation-context (v1.0.1) and session-rename (v1.0.0)
  • git-commit-conversation-context enforces conversation context in commits with skill integration
  • session-rename suggests descriptive session names before ending

What problem does it solve?

Agent-assisted commits and anonymous session titles leave your git history and session list useless when you revisit shipped work.

Who is it for?

Solo builders who commit often from Claude Code and want structured messages plus searchable session names without manual rituals.

Skip if: Teams with rigid commit bots that conflict with local hooks, or developers who never use Claude Code session history.

What do I get? / Deliverables

After installing both plugins, commits carry conversation context and sessions get descriptive names so review and discovery are faster.

  • git-commit-conversation-context plugin active
  • session-rename prompts integrated before session end
